Figure shows two unequal point charges Q1 = +4C and Q2 = -2C. The distance between them is 16 cm.
I) Where, in what region could a net E- field due to this combination be 0. Show calculation.

II) find the distance, r, from q = -2 C where the net E-field is 0.

Explanation / Answer
negative charge has E towards it and positive charge has E away from it....so in region II the E's add up and they wont be 0
region III
let E=0 be at a distance x from -2c charge then
Q1/(R+x)^2 = Q2/x^2
4/(16+x)^2 =2/x^2
2x^2=256+x^2+32x
x^2-32x-256=0
x= 38.627 cm
